Transaction 26fd149f42a1d68e7c50401b689b6175555a46e825aaf2aae393c088f92e1ed3
1 Input
1 Output
-
26fd149f42a1d68e7c50401b689b6175555a46e825aaf2aae393c088f92e1ed3:0
- value
- 490357
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6deb7833e2ec9b0c370060a8856f74fa8d0849d OP_EQUAL
- address
- 3MH9LEUs2cTSxCLD7UzhCHrfzsdMa7Ztoq